Refer to Table 10.12 for troubleshooting instructions for particular situations.
Table 10.12 Troubleshooting
Problem Possible Cause Solution
The device ENABLED front-panel LED is
dark.
Input power is not present or a fuse is
blown.
Self-test failure.
Verify that input power is present.
View the self-test failure message on the
front-panel display.
The device front-panel display does not
show characters.
The device front panel has timed out.
The device is de-energized.
Press the ESC pushbutton to activate the dis-
play.
Verify input power and fuse continuity.
The device does not accurately measure
transducer values.
Wiring error.
Incorrect AI settings (Device settings).
Verify input wiring.
Verify AI settings.
The device does not respond to commands
from a device connected to the serial port.
Cable is not connected.
Cable is the incorrect type.
The device of communicating device has
communications mismatch(es).
The device serial port has received an
XOFF, halting communications.
Verify the cable connections.
Verify the cable pinout.
Verify device communications parameters.
Type <Ctrl+Q> to send the device XON
and restart communications.
